I have 3 girls and our childminder has gone. We've decided to take the plunge and get an Aupair. We also decided we'd rather choose our own. The agency's don't seam to offer much really that I can't do myself.

So I signed up to aupair.com and had about 200 applications, I think this is due to the time of year.

We Skyed with one that I really like, my question is for those experienced what questions would you be asking?

I've told her exactly what we are offering and what we expect from her.

I'm slightly worried about food from some posts.

Do you pay for her flights to come over? Obviously I'll collect her from the airport.

Any other newby advise would be great!!

No we don't pay flights. They can after all leave any time they choose.
Food for us is a deal breaker. No fussy eaters, no vegetarians, no vegans. They don't have to be able to cook.
I think you get a good or bad feel for people. I only talk to one at a time.
